从刑 (cōng) — accessory punishment (in law, e.g. deprivation of political rights)

Définition

从刑 (cōngxíng) is a law term for an accessory punishment imposed alongside a main sentence — e.g. loss of political rights or fines — rather than a standalone penalty.

noun
accessory punishment (in law, e.g. deprivation of political rights)
